How to Make Curried Garbanzo Beans
- In a medium saucepan, heat 1/2 inch of water (about 1 cup). Add 1 teaspoon curry powder, 1/2 teaspoon cumin, 1/4 teaspoon turmeric, and a pinch of salt. Cook for 2-3 minutes, stirring constantly, until fragrant.
- Add 1 (15-ounce) can of garbanzo beans, drained and rinsed, and enough water to barely cover the beans (about 1/2 cup).
- Bring to a simmer, then reduce heat to medium-low. Mash a few of the garbanzo beans with a potato masher or fork to thicken the sauce.
- Simmer for 15-20 minutes, stirring frequently, until the sauce has thickened to your desired consistency.
- Remove from heat and stir in the juice of 1/2 lemon, 1/4 cup chopped fresh cilantro, and 1/2 cup chopped tomato.
- Taste and adjust seasonings with salt and pepper as needed. Serve hot or cold over basmati rice.
